Contact University of Alabama For More Info
Select Your Overall Recommendation
Fremont, CA
San Francisco, CA
Mechanicsburg, PA
Mountain View, CA
1 Community Review 5/5 Overall Rating
Have done a lot of business with them and they are always very organized.
Strengths: Seems like an unlikely source, but they are extremely professional.
Needs to improve: Not very well-known.